I think you'll find saxon's directory input feature applies teh
stylesheet to all the files in teh directory, so you'll get xml parse
errors on the images.

Instead of doing that you can use the collection() function and just select the xml
files with  a URL ending with directory-name/?select=*.xml
see the saxon documentation.
